📄 index.html
字号:
<span><span style="font-family: Verdana"><strong><span style="font-size: 16pt">YUV2ANY</span></strong><br />
<br />
</span><strong>
<br />
<span style="font-family: Verdana">Description:</span></strong><br />
<br />
<span style="font-family: Verdana">
This project is small command line tool for image conversion into YUV color space. Currently support BMP, JPEG, PNG, PCX, TGA and GIF as input images (uses Corona library). In future planned support of video sequences such as MPEG-2. Tool can work in "multiple input files" mode and produce on output all-in-one file or separated YUV files. Types of output YUV images is very wide. Tool support standart formats like a YUV4:2:0, YUV4:2:2 and 4:4:4. Also tool support conversion in some exotic formats that comes from JPEG standart: H2V2(same as 4:2:0), H2V1 (same as 4:2:2), H1V2 and H1V1(same as 4:4:4). Output format of YUV images can be planar (color components separated on planes [Y0, Y1, ..., Yn][U0,
U1, ..., Un][V0, V1, ..., Vn]) and mixed (all color componens are mixed [Y0, U0,
Y1, V0, Y2, U1, Y3, V1, ....]).<br />
<br />
Tool was written for Microsoft Windows platform but it can be easly ported to any others, because sources don't contain win32 specific code.<br />
<br />
</span><span style="font-family: Verdana"><strong>Usage:<br />
<br />
</strong><span style="font-family: Courier New">any2yuv.exe [options] <input_file(s)>
<output_file(s)><br />
Options:<br />
-a : Add new image to the end of output file. Don't truncate output
file.<br />
-t <h2v2|h2v1|h1v2|h1v1|uvyv|yuyv> : Type of output YUV image(s).<br />
-m <first> <last> <n>
: Multiple input file mode. Where:<br />
first : first enumerator<br />
last : last enumerator<br />
size : enumerator size (3 for 001, 5 for 00001)<br />
-c : Output as C/C++ source. Default: binary mode<br />
<br />
Note: Use symbol '$' in file names for enumerators.<br />
<br />
Examples:<br />
any2yuv.exe -a -m 0 100 3 test$.bmp out.yuv<br />
Convert images from 'test000.bmp' to 'test100.bmp' into single 'out.yuv'
file<br />
<br />
any2yuv.exe -m 10 200 5 test$.jpg out$.yuv<br />
Convert images 'test00010.jpg'...'test00200.jpg' into files 'out00010.yuv'...'out00200.yuv'<br />
<br />
<span style="font-family: Verdana">
<br />
<strong>Sources:<br />
<br />
</strong> For last sources follow by this link.<br />
<br />
<strong>Binaries:<br />
<br />
</strong> For last binaries follow by this link.</span></span></span></span>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-